Mothman, The Man release new song ‘Too Long’

MOTHMAN, THE MAN have released a brand new song!

The new song, titled Too Long, is taken from the Falmouth-based psych/garage rock band’s upcoming new album, Where’s Your Head?, which is scheduled to be released in April this year.

Speaking about the new song, frontman Connor Childs says, “it’s a stoner and sludge-infused psychedelic track about the themes of lost and unrequited love…but ironically though. It’s more of a parody/tongue-in-cheek look at the cheesy, overserious psychedelic love songs of the late ’60s and early ’70s through a modern lens. This was the first track that I wrote out of all of the tracks on the album, and it served as a great reference point for the sound/songwriting approach I would incorporate into the rest of the writing process.
